What can you measure with EASY-CHECK FE-S ?
On iron and steel (FE) all non-magnetic coatings, such as varnish,
paint, plastics, enamel, rubber, ceramics and galvanization (except
niquel) up to 5 mm.
In addition EASY-CHECK FE-S includes the following features
•Store up to 1000 readings in the data memory
•Display statistics
•Transfer all readings and statistics to a printer or computer by means
of the interface, or just
•Transfer the data by RADIO.
All these functions can be performed with the red key.

FUNCTION MODES
Switch on the device by pressing the key until <on> is displayed. Re-
lease the key.
When you now press the key once again for a longer time the
following modes will appear one after another:
Sto = Store readings in the Data Memory
StA = Display Statistics
Prn = Print or activate the Serial Interface
IcL = Clear the last reading
cLr = Clear the whole Data Memory
un = Change the unit of measurement (µm / mils)
rES = Switch over the resolution: 0.1 or 1.0 µm
By pressing the key the mode selected is confirmed.
OPERATION OF THE FUNCTION MODES
<Sto> Store readings in the Data Memory
To store readings in the memory for further evaluation press the key until
<Sto> is displayed.
Now release the key and press it again for confirmation and wait until
<on> is displayed.
The data memory is activated and all subsequent measurements will be
stored. The symbol <STORE> is displayed to make evident that the
memory is switched on.

5
Capacity of the data memory : 1000 readings
When the memory has reached its capacity limit the symbol <FUL> is
displayed.
As soon as the device is switched off the memory mode is deactivated.
<StA> Display Statistics
The readings stored in the data memory are evaluated as follows:
No. - Number of readings stored
MIN - Lowest reading stored
MAX - Highest reading stored
MEAN - Mean value
STD.DEV. - Standard deviation
Press the key until the symbol <StA> appears. Now release the key and
press it again to confirm. The statistics values are displayed one after
another.
<Prn> Print or Activate the RADIO CONTROL function
When EASY-CHECK FE-S is connected to the printer MEGA-PRINT or
operated with the RADIO CONTROL module, press the key until <prn>
is displayed. Then release the key and press it again to start the data
transfer.
This is not necessary when working with the interface cable and the
software selected. As soon as the interface cable is connected, the data
transfer starts by itself without pressing the key.
<IcL> Clear the last reading
Press the key until the symbol <IcL> is displayed. Release the key
shortly and press it again to confirm.
Now the last reading is cleared.

6
<cLr> Clear the whole Data Memory
Press the key until the symbol <cLr> is displayed. Release the key
shortly and press it again to confirm.
Now the whole Data Memory is cleared.
<Un> Change unit of measurement (µm / mils)
In its basic setting the instrument measures in µm.
To measure in “mils” (American unit of measurement) press the key until
the symbol <un>is displayed. Release the key and press it again to con-
firm.
When you switch on the instrument again it will measures in “mils”.
To change over to “µm” proceed in the same way.
<rES> Resolution
From factory the device is adjusted to the resolution 1.0 µm.
To switch over to the resolution 0.1 µm press the key until <rES> is
displayed. Release the key shortly and press it again to confirm the set-
ting.
CALIBRATION
You receive the device already calibrated. Nevertheless from time to
time it is necessary to check or correct the calibration. This is especially
recommended when you measure on small or curved objects or when
the surface of the test object is rough.
To calibrate the device you should always use the shim with the
higher value (approx. 300 µm). The shim with the lower value
(approx. 100 µm) is only supplied to verify the accuracy after
calibration.

7
•Switch on the device.
•Set the device with the probe on the base plate FE (blue) and press
the key for about 2 sec until <0.0> is displayed stable. Then release
the key and zero setting is performed and confirmed by a beep sig-
nal
•Take off the device, <cAl> is flashing.
•Press the key and the actual calibration value is displayed. This
value should be identical with your shim value (approx. 300 µm). If it
is not, you now can enter the correct value. Pressing the key shortly
the value goes down by 1, pressing it continuously the value scrolls
up.
•Once the correct calibration value is set, place the shim (approx.
300 µm) on the base plate FE (blue) and set the device on the shim
and wait until the beep sounds.
The device is calibrated.
To perform just a one-point calibration and after having set the zero
point, you can go on taking measurements while <cAl> is flashing. The
flashing <cAl> disappears on the display as soon as a new measure-
ment is taken.
When measuring on small or curved objects it is advisable to perform
calibration on a bare test object with the same geometry of the
object to be measured and not on the base plate supplied with the de-
vice.
EXCHANGE OF THE BATTERY
As soon as the symbol <BAT> is flashing the battery must be exchanged
by a new one.
When the voltage of the battery is less than 0.8 V the device switches off
by itself.

CHARGE THE 1.2V RECHARGEABLE BATTERY WITH THE
LINE-CHARGING UNIT
As soon as the symbol <BAT> is flashing the rechargeable 1.2V Mignon
battery must be charged.
Important: Before inserting the charging connector into the interface
plug of EASY-CHECK FE-S the device must be switched off.
The charger must not be connected when the 1.5V battery is inside
the device. The battery may run out and destroy the device !
With the device switched off the charging connector is inserted into the
interface plug of EASY-CHECK FE-S. The device switches on by itself
and a bar diagram with the battery symbol is displayed. With the charger
connected you can go on taking measurements.
After approx. 20 sec the state of charge is displayed again provided no
measurement is taken. When the charger is connected the automatic
switch off is deactivated.
The rechargeable battery needs approx. 8 hours to be charged com-
pletely. A constant bar diagram is flashing together with the battery sym-
bol and the charger can be removed.
GENERAL REMARKS
Thickness of the base material: at least 300 µm
Automatic switch-off
The device switches off automatically one minute after the last measu-
rement. The instrument can also be switched off with the red key.
IMPORTANT
The probe should not be drawn across the testing surface but reset at
different spots, i.e. after each measurement hold the instrument in the air
for about 1 sec. In doing so the stored calibration is automatically che-
cked and corrected if necessary.
Make sure that the probe surface and the base plate are kept clean
and polished at all times.

TECHNICAL DATA
Measuring Technique: Magnetic induction on iron and steel
(ISO 2178)
Measuring Range: 0 – 5000 µm
Indication: LCD 3½ digits with floating decimal point
and guides for operation
Resolution: selectable 1.0 µm or 0.1 µm
Accuracy: below 100 µm: ±1 µm
100 - 1000 µm: ±1 %
1000 - 2000 µm: ±3 %
> 2000 µm: ±5 %
Memory: max. 1000 readings
Statistics Indication of No.-MIN-MAX-MEAN-STD.DEV.
Power Supply: 1,5V Mignon battery
(1.2V rechargeable battery with charger
available)
Recording Data: one long beep
Measuring Probe: swinging by 90°
Dimensions: 108 x 48 x 38 mm
Weight:approx. 100 g
Interface: serial RS 232 C (5 V TTL level)
Baudrate: Printer + PC: 1200 baud
Data/Stop bits: Printer + PC: 7/2
Warranty: Indication unit: 12 months
Measuring probe: 3 months

DATA PRINTER MEGA-PRINT
Technical Data:
Type of Printer: Thermo printer
Characters/Line: 16
Data Transfer Rate: 1200 baud
Printing Velocity: max. 20 lines/sec.
Interface: serial
Paper: Thermo paper
57 mm wide, max. 10 m long
Power Supply: Rechargeable NiCad battery
(approx. 60 hours operation/charge)
Size: 110 x 80 x 45 mm
Weight:approx. 240 g
Charging Unit: 230 V/50 Hz / 6.0 V – 0.5 A
Charging the built-in NiCad Battery
Before using MEGA-PRINT for the first time the built-in NiCad battery
must be charged.
The built-in NiCad battery is charged with the charging unit supplied with
the printer. The cable of the charging unit is connected at the right-hand
socket of MEGA-PRINT.
The charging time should be at least 4 hours.
Operating Instructions
1. The operation of MEGA-PRINT together with the Coating Thickness
Meter EASY-CHECK FE-S is explained in the operating instructions of
EASY-CHECK FE-S (Page 5).
2. When the printer MEGA-PRINT is connected to the Coating Thickness
Meter EASY-CHECK FE-S, MEGA-PRINT switches on automatically
(the green LED flashes every 2 sec). When switching off
EASY-CHECK FE-S, the printer is switched off automatically (the green
LED remains switched off).

12
3. The manual paper feed is performed with the key „Paperfeed“. When
the printout is finished the paper stripe is transported out of the casing
by pressing this key and can be neatly turned off.
4. Faulty print out
Incorrect printed lines mean that the printer should be recharged.
